Classroom To Be Rules
To Be PREPARED
Be on time with supplies and completed assignment.
To Be RESPECTFUL
Be considerate of yourself, others and property by listening carefully and following directions. Provide assistance and help appropriately.
To Be HELPFUL To Be PROUD
Consequences
Positive Consequences (rewards): - Praise and verbal compliments - Smiles - High fives - Positive notes - Certificate of - Fun Friday (entire class must earn this) Negative Consequences: - The look warning - Private conversation - Work separately - Fill out think sheet - Call parent or meeting with faculty - Involve the principal as last resort/Referral Please note: in severe cases students will not be given a referral without other warnings.

Collecting Papers
Pencil Sharpening
Tardy
Absent
Show Mrs. Jones your pass/note. Check the absent pick up folder for your missing work slip and any worksheets. Copy down the missed bell ringer and notes from a peer. Absent work is to be turned in the following class period in the absent turn in folder. If you miss a test you need to schedule a time with Mrs. Jones to make up the test. I will not track you down to give or collect absent work. It is your responsibility.

We dont have test but celebration of knowledge! Cok! Late work late work is to be turned into the late work folder. Late work hurts you the student and will also lower your work habits rating. You cannot master a standard with late work. Late work can be turned in up until the second to last week of each quarter. Absent work for every day you are absent you have that many days to complete your work. Procedure: when you return to class, go to the absent pick up folder and find your page of information. Once completed return to absent turn in.
Grading/Report Cards
Please note that your homework should not take more than 30-45 minutes a night. If you are having troubles and you have honestly put forth your best effort, have your parents sign the assignment. A signed assignment means that you will be staying after school for help. However, the assignment will NOT be considered late.
